• grrgyle@slrpnk.net
    link
    fedilink
    arrow-up
    1
    ·
    6 days ago

    I’ve really been struggling lately in a way that feels more serious than ever before lol

  • CultLeader4Hire@lemmy.world
    link
    fedilink
    arrow-up
    2
    ·
    7 days ago

    I had to teach myself to say lol all the time via text and it absolutely helps with tone, so does using emoji which was something else I had to force myself to do. I seem less mature I guess but I don’t come off as a blunt asshole anymore and my conversations go a lot smoother

    • Monte_Crisco@thelemmy.club
      link
      fedilink
      arrow-up
      2
      ·
      7 days ago

      I’m afraid I’ve used “lol” so much for so many years that this is exactly how people will interpret my texts if I suddenly stop now.

    • mika_mika@lemmy.world
      link
      fedilink
      arrow-up
      0
      ·
      7 days ago

      I have been called weird or passive aggressive for using punctuation in my text messages. Why do we cater to these people? Why do I care about the opinion of someone who takes to heart whether I use an exclamation point or period at the end of a sentence? It should have been their problem to learn to not make assumptions.

      • SkyeStarfall@lemmy.blahaj.zone
        link
        fedilink
        arrow-up
        2
        ·
        6 days ago

        Because you’re not following social conventions

        It’s also up to you to learn to work with others, conversation is a cooperative game. If you don’t give enough signs, people don’t know the tone you are intending to give over text, because body language and verbal tone is missing. That’s the purpose of the informal conventions

        It’s your problem to learn too

  • rarWars@lemmy.blahaj.zone
    link
    fedilink
    arrow-up
    1
    ·
    6 days ago

    I’m Gen Z and I use lol as punctuation at the end of a sentence to indicate a lighthearted tone, just like a ? or ! indicate their respective tones. It’s very useful, and I think I’ll keep using it lol

    It fills a similar niche to tone tags but somewhat less intrusive imo.

    • karashta@sopuli.xyz
      link
      fedilink
      arrow-up
      1
      ·
      6 days ago

      This has how it’s always been used as far as I have seen as an older millennial, aside from being used in a form of irony.

      It’s an upbeat tone indicator. But it’s not the same as sending someone a smile with your text.

      It fills a useful niche. Just like /s also does.

  • DiabolicalBird@lemmy.ca
    link
    fedilink
    arrow-up
    1
    ·
    7 days ago

    Tone is an absolute bitch to convey properly over text, if you don’t add indicators it’s up to the reader to determine the tone you’re using. Miscommunication causes larger problems. Using lol helps indicate a lighter tone so people don’t think I’m pissed off or grumpy when I’m not

  • Klear@quokk.au
    link
    fedilink
    English
    arrow-up
    1
    ·
    7 days ago

    What I want… No. What I need is a browser extension that would change every “lol” on every page into a small picture of a TIE Fighter. It would make that flyby noise if you put your mouse over it and you could blow it up by clicking.

      • zout@fedia.io
        link
        fedilink
        arrow-up
        0
        ·
        7 days ago

        Your comment triggered me to ask an LLM to create it, and it came up with something. I’m not going to test it though, so we’ll never know if it works. I’d advise anyone not to try it. It gave links to an image and a sound file that gave a 404 error. LLM output:

        Here’s a complete Firefox extension that replaces the text “lol” with a TIE Fighter image, plays a sound on hover, and changes the image on click.

        🔧 Firefox Extension: “Lol to TIE Fighter”

        1. Manifest File (manifest.json)
        {
          "manifest_version": 2,
          "name": "Lol to TIE Fighter",
          "version": "1.0",
          "description": "Replaces 'lol' with a TIE Fighter image and plays sound on hover.",
          "permissions": [
            "activeScript",
            "scripting",
            "https://example.com/*"
          ],
          "content_scripts": [
            {
              "matches": ["<all_urls>"],
              "js": ["content.js"]
            }
          ],
          "background": {
            "scripts": ["background.js"]
          },
          "options_page": "options.html"
        }
        
        1. Content Script (content.js)
        document.addEventListener("DOMContentLoaded", function() {
          function replaceTextNodesWithImages() {
            const walker = document.createTreeWalker(document.body, NodeFilter.SHOW_TEXT, null, false);
            let node;
            while (node = walker.nextNode()) {
              if (node.textContent.includes("lol")) {
                const img = document.createElement("img");
                img.src = "https://example.com/tie-fighter.png"; // Replace with your image URL
                img.style.width = "20px";
                img.style.height = "20px";
                img.style.display = "inline-block";
                img.style.cursor = "pointer";
        
                // Sound on hover
                img.addEventListener("mouseover", () => playSound());
        
                // Blow up on click
                img.addEventListener("click", () => blowUp(img));
        
                node.replaceWith(img);
              }
            }
          }
        
          replaceTextNodesWithImages();
        });
        
        function playSound() {
          const audio = new Audio("https://example.com/sound.mp3"); // Replace with your sound URL
          audio.play();
        }
        
        function blowUp(img) {
          img.src = "https://example.com/blowup.png"; // Replace with a larger image or "none"
          img.style.width = "40px";
          img.style.height = "40px";
        }
        
        1. Image and Sound Requirements TIE Fighter Image: Replace the URL in content.js with a public domain image. Example: TIE Fighter Image from Wikipedia Sound Effect: Replace the URL with a .mp3 file hosted on your server. Example: Sound Effect from FreeSound.org 🛠️ How to Use Create the files: manifest.json content.js Load the extension in Firefox: Go to about:debugging in Firefox. Click Add Extension and select the folder with your files. Test on any website with “lol” text. ⚠️ Notes Image/Sound URLs: Replace the URLs with your own hosted or public domain assets. Performance: This script runs on every page, so consider optimizing for large sites. Security: Ensure the image and sound URLs are secure to avoid errors. This extension replaces “lol” with a TIE Fighter image, plays a sound on hover, and expands the image on click. Adjust the URLs to match your assets!
        • bountygiver [any]@lemmy.ml
          link
          fedilink
          English
          arrow-up
          1
          ·
          7 days ago

          your LLM misunderstood the request, it is going to replace the entire sentence (or the entire comment/post) into the TIE fighter if it contains the “lol”, not just the part where it is “lol”. Also the “blow up” is not explosion, it thought it means “making it big”